MONARCH
Definitions of MONARCH
- The ruler of an absolute monarchy or the head of state of a constitutional monarchy.
- The chief or best thing of its kind.
- Any bird of the family Monarchidae.
- A monarch butterfly (Danaus plexippus) and others of genus Danaus, found primarily in North America, so called because of the designs on its wings.
- (Aboriginal English) A police officer.
- (often capitalised) A stag which has sixteen or more points or tines on its antlers.
- A surname.
